summary |
shortlog | log |
commit |
commitdiff |
tree
first ⋅ prev ⋅ next
Haegeun Park [Fri, 27 Jul 2012 09:19:23 +0000 (02:19 -0700)]
[Title] Added a new memory tracing feature(and some minor updates)
[Issue#] J number N/A
[Problem] N/A
[Cause] N/A
[Solution] Changed following items
- Added a new memory tracing feature (client allocated textures and renderbuffers)
COREGL_TRACE_MEM=1
- A PID is notified on the top of all tracing message
- Added context tracing when FASTPATH is disabled
- Added a BUILD-DATE info on the launching message
[COREGL] <PID> (BUILD-DATE) Library initializing...
- Disabled APPOPT logs
- Fix minor bugs
invalid value of 'Swaps per sec' of the API trace
Haegeun Park [Tue, 17 Jul 2012 04:58:10 +0000 (21:58 -0700)]
Add EGL/GLES2 wrapper library for build
- You should not commit library file(binary)
- Currently EGL/GL/COREGL versions are set to 3.0
DO NOT BRAKE or MODIFY any library linkages (include symbolic links)
GOOD Example (using tar) :
COREGL/lib$ tar cvzf COREGL_LIBRARY.tgz *
(TARGET) $ tar xvzf COREGL_LIBRARY.tgz
BAD Example (using cp) :
COREGL/lib$ cp libCOREGL.so.3.0 (TARGET)/libCOREGL.so.1.1
Wonsik Jung [Thu, 5 Jul 2012 04:49:32 +0000 (13:49 +0900)]
Merge "[Trace] Add 'MAX elapsed time' at API tracing module"
Park SangHee [Fri, 29 Jun 2012 00:23:50 +0000 (09:23 +0900)]
output file name change
Haegeun Park [Thu, 28 Jun 2012 13:27:31 +0000 (06:27 -0700)]
[Trace] Add 'MAX elapsed time' at API tracing module
- Minor bug fixes (STATE tracing module)
Haegeun Park [Thu, 28 Jun 2012 12:19:12 +0000 (05:19 -0700)]
Add 'libdl.so' link to Makefile. (Fix linkage test error)
Haegeun Park [Wed, 20 Jun 2012 05:59:40 +0000 (22:59 -0700)]
[Refactoring] Modularization
- Fastpath : fast egl-context module
- Tracepath : API/CTX/STATE tracing module
- Appopt : Application specific optimization module
* Modify entrypoint for EGL symbol (workaround for fork() issue)
Haegeun Park [Wed, 13 Jun 2012 07:45:31 +0000 (00:45 -0700)]
Release EGL resources associated with a EGLDisplay in eglTerminate()
Haegeun Park [Wed, 30 May 2012 07:16:09 +0000 (00:16 -0700)]
Refactored wrapping layer
- Enhance performance for no-tracing path
- API trace is now enabled
- Minor bug fixes
Seo Minsu [Thu, 10 May 2012 05:09:16 +0000 (14:09 +0900)]
upload library
Haegeun Park [Thu, 10 May 2012 04:24:07 +0000 (21:24 -0700)]
Merge branch 'master' of slp-info.sec.samsung.net:slp/pkgs/c/coregl
Haegeun Park [Wed, 9 May 2012 08:14:45 +0000 (01:14 -0700)]
Added unlikely hint of trace branch (Need to check performance)
Wonsik Jung [Wed, 9 May 2012 07:30:45 +0000 (16:30 +0900)]
Merge "Fix missed handling of glGet() for wrapped objects"
Haegeun Park [Wed, 9 May 2012 07:02:34 +0000 (00:02 -0700)]
Fix missed handling of glGet() for wrapped objects
- FishTank first-frame lock issue is solved
Minsu Han [Wed, 9 May 2012 03:17:31 +0000 (12:17 +0900)]
Update Makefile
Change-Id: I99ef34b64b61b203763167f81638ca24341eb0ab
Minsu Han [Wed, 9 May 2012 00:55:43 +0000 (09:55 +0900)]
add opengl-es-20 pkgconfig
Change-Id: I20f4555ec9991b6d708f4fd60203aebace5c5df4
Park SangHee [Tue, 8 May 2012 11:35:11 +0000 (20:35 +0900)]
Disable coregl api logging
Wonsik Jung [Fri, 4 May 2012 06:10:39 +0000 (15:10 +0900)]
add Makefile
Haegeun Park [Fri, 4 May 2012 04:45:30 +0000 (21:45 -0700)]
Optimized CTX, STATE tracing (add more if statements)
- Context hashing cost is reduced
Haegeun Park [Thu, 3 May 2012 07:32:24 +0000 (00:32 -0700)]
Major updates
- Handled bind API
- File could be specified for trace output (COREGL_LOG_FILE=<filename>)
- Avoided Mali MP4 DDK surface resize bug (Solves first-scene issue of evas app)
- Optimized API tracing module (Reduces CPU costs)
- Fix minor bugs
Haegeun Park [Thu, 3 May 2012 06:39:09 +0000 (23:39 -0700)]
Fix return value of eglBindTexImage()
Haegeun Park [Wed, 2 May 2012 08:45:56 +0000 (01:45 -0700)]
Fix gl error reset bug
Haegeun Park [Wed, 2 May 2012 06:38:47 +0000 (23:38 -0700)]
Fix performance issue (gettimeofday() moved)
Park SangHee [Thu, 26 Apr 2012 09:00:09 +0000 (18:00 +0900)]
Modify pkgconfig
Park SangHee [Thu, 26 Apr 2012 08:33:10 +0000 (17:33 +0900)]
Package Upload
Park SangHee [Thu, 26 Apr 2012 08:27:47 +0000 (17:27 +0900)]
change changelog format
Park SangHee [Thu, 26 Apr 2012 07:09:01 +0000 (16:09 +0900)]
Package Upload
Park SangHee [Thu, 26 Apr 2012 06:46:35 +0000 (15:46 +0900)]
modify spec file
Wonsik Jung [Thu, 26 Apr 2012 06:29:25 +0000 (15:29 +0900)]
modify architecture for only ARM
Park SangHee [Thu, 26 Apr 2012 04:21:20 +0000 (13:21 +0900)]
Package Upload
Park SangHee [Wed, 25 Apr 2012 07:39:05 +0000 (16:39 +0900)]
fix bug related to postinst
Park SangHee [Wed, 18 Apr 2012 00:26:40 +0000 (09:26 +0900)]
Package Upload
Park SangHee [Wed, 18 Apr 2012 00:16:22 +0000 (09:16 +0900)]
Fix postinst file
Wonsik Jung [Mon, 16 Apr 2012 04:49:44 +0000 (13:49 +0900)]
Merge "Add fpgl-call error handling when makecurrent=null (instead of assertion) Add new option 'COREGL_TRACE_CTX_FORCE=1' for chasing every context changes (with CORGEL_TRACE_CTX=1)"
Haegeun Park [Mon, 16 Apr 2012 04:34:32 +0000 (21:34 -0700)]
Add fpgl-call error handling when makecurrent=null (instead of assertion)
Add new option 'COREGL_TRACE_CTX_FORCE=1' for chasing every context changes (with CORGEL_TRACE_CTX=1)
Wonsik Jung [Sat, 14 Apr 2012 07:38:16 +0000 (16:38 +0900)]
fix build error
Wonsik Jung [Fri, 13 Apr 2012 07:08:48 +0000 (16:08 +0900)]
add debianlize
Haegeun Park [Thu, 12 Apr 2012 13:09:46 +0000 (06:09 -0700)]
Sync with released version for TIZEN 1.0 demo
Updates since last release:
- Separted globally shared gl objects to local contexts
(texture, buffer, framebuffer, renderbuffer, program)
- Enhance tracing & performance
- Added gl-error handling
- Added handling functions for some extensions
- Fixed dlsym link bug & hided unused symbols
Haegeun Park [Mon, 26 Mar 2012 04:41:42 +0000 (21:41 -0700)]
Initial Commit
eunmee.moon [Fri, 23 Mar 2012 01:45:36 +0000 (10:45 +0900)]
Initial empty repository